KVM (Kernel-based Virtual Machine) provides open-source virtualization on Linux Operating System (OS). Open this page: ozekiphone.com If you use KVM you can run more than one OS on a single computer. Each virtual machines have an own vitualized part such as the disk, network card and graphics adapter. The Kernel is the base for some operating systems and functions as a bridge between softwares and information processing. Virtualization means that you create virtual operating systems, hardware components, storage devices and even network resources. The Ozeki Phone System XE runs on Windows. If you use a different OS, you can have an Ozeki Phone System XE network if you virtualize a Windows on your computer. Of course, you can do it with a KVM. As a Windows is on your computer, the installation and maintaining of your Ozeki Phone System XE can be used without trouble.
